[Android] Replace DirectoryRepository with CustomDirectories
Habib Kazemi
git at videolan.org
Thu Aug 30 10:10:05 CEST 2018
vlc-android | branch: master | Habib Kazemi <kazemihabib1996 at gmail.com> | Tue Aug 21 19:06:34 2018 +0430| [4aa75b7b860c8d48e7a43be4b3aef09a5549ee00] | committer: Geoffrey Métais
Replace DirectoryRepository with CustomDirectories
Some functions moved from AndroidDevices to DirectoryRepository
FilePickerFragment and StorageBrowserAdapter and StorageBrowserFragment
converted to kotlin to support DirectoryRepository suspend functions.
Signed-off-by: Geoffrey Métais <geoffrey.metais at gmail.com>
> https://code.videolan.org/videolan/vlc-android/commit/4aa75b7b860c8d48e7a43be4b3aef09a5549ee00
---
.../src/org/videolan/vlc/MediaParsingService.kt | 3 +-
.../vlc/gui/browser/FilePickerFragment.java | 127 ----------
.../videolan/vlc/gui/browser/FilePickerFragment.kt | 122 ++++++++++
.../vlc/gui/browser/StorageBrowserAdapter.java | 102 --------
.../vlc/gui/browser/StorageBrowserAdapter.kt | 101 ++++++++
.../vlc/gui/browser/StorageBrowserFragment.java | 261 ---------------------
.../vlc/gui/browser/StorageBrowserFragment.kt | 233 ++++++++++++++++++
.../src/org/videolan/vlc/gui/tv/MainTvFragment.kt | 9 +-
.../vlc/gui/video/VideoPlayerActivity.java | 7 +-
.../org/videolan/vlc/providers/BrowserProvider.kt | 1 +
.../videolan/vlc/providers/FileBrowserProvider.kt | 60 ++---
.../org/videolan/vlc/providers/StorageProvider.kt | 39 +--
.../videolan/vlc/repository/CustomDirectories.java | 89 -------
.../videolan/vlc/repository/DirectoryRepository.kt | 46 +++-
.../src/org/videolan/vlc/util/AndroidDevices.java | 34 ---
15 files changed, 561 insertions(+), 673 deletions(-)
Diff: https://code.videolan.org/videolan/vlc-android/commit/4aa75b7b860c8d48e7a43be4b3aef09a5549ee00
More information about the Android
mailing list